Overview

Server power supply monitoring module, single port theoretical maximum 25A, supports CSPS server power supply, the current 460w HP power supply is used.
Because the schematic and PCB have been made public (you can directly build the board and verify that there are no errors), if you want to develop the program yourself, you can use the included program of Code.zip to shorten the development cycle (the code is not well written). I will also release the HEX program file, but to download it you need to use the ICP tool of the AT32 official website, which can be obtained from the official website of Artly, but you need to use AT-Link or J-Link to download (I tried to use the ISP tool to download using serial port 1 but it was unsuccessful. . . can set the total power of the connected server power supply to match the display (default is 460w) (do not modify it) Yes) (Parameter 1 is the reading interval and can not be changed) (Parameter 2 is the amplification speed of the current sampling chip, ina180A1 is 20 times, A2 is 50 times) (Parameter 3 is the total power of the server power supply) (Parameter 4 is the sampling resistor value) (If you strictly follow the BOM table, you don’t need to change anything except parameter 3 when the power supply is different.)
